Getting Real About Dropshipping

Dropshipping is simple, but it is not easy. You may have come across dropshippers claiming to make loads of money. They may be true, but we'll bet our top dollar that it was not with their first store. Building a lucrative dropshipping store takes hard work. Let us break down that reality for you.

Persevere When the Going Gets Tough

Magda: Definitely. Most of the successful dropshippers that we talk to have had multiple stores and have spent so much money learning Facebook Ads, figuring out how ads work, figuring out which products actually are not good at all to sell.

Harry: When I started to launch some adverts, probably… We spent through about 800 pounds, which converted into about $1,000 or so, only to generate one sale.

Magda: And once they’ve become professionals and once they’ve done it for long enough, then yes, they can launch a store and in one week make, let’s say, six figures. But it is not their first store. 

I know for myself personally, that I have had seven failed dropshipping stores and every single store has been a lesson and something that I’ve learned and taken to the next one.

But it definitely takes some failures before you really figure it out.

Jessica: People might hear, “Oh my gosh, that sounds like a lot of money.” The truth is, yes, if you are on your last $100 in your bank account, I’m sorry, but this is not the week to start Facebook advertising. You’re not gonna get very far, you’re not gonna be able to act on the data that you get. 

That doesn’t mean you can’t start dropshipping with other means that require a lot of time, building, for example, Instagram communities, from the ground up over months but with zero dollars. You just gotta make that decision and a lot of people think I can start with $5 and nothing else in the bank and go to $2,000 with no experience. And we hope we haven’t given you that impression. It’s really important that when we talk about failures, you can really break it down and you really understand that failures can mean a lot of different things, whether it be your store failing, or whether it be your Facebook ad failing or whether it be your first winning product failing and not working. 

It’s really important to know that failure can come in all shapes and sizes, and every failure is a lesson. That sounds so cheesy. I know you’ve probably heard that so many times before. Unfortunately, it is the truth. And once you start believing it and living by that mantra, you’ll be able to find success with any sort of dropshipping store. 

Success comes in many shapes and sizes

And I think that that’s one really important lesson that you should learn and take from any dropshipping videos you watch on YouTube, or any big ecommerce entrepreneurs that you really look up to. None of them have a single path to success.

They’ve all failed multiple times and failed in many different ways. But the difference is they keep it moving.

So whether it’s testing three winning products or 20, yes, many dropshippers test up to 20 products before they find one that actually works for them and makes them a lot of money. But the difference between them and people who are not successful is they just keep trying and they’re willing to keep pushing until they find the one that works for them.
